I can't solve this problem: starting solidworks 2015 student edition x64, when it tries to initialize VBA engine, appears a message saying "Failed to initialize visual basic for apps, equations and macros will not work. Are you low on disc space?" and I'm not able to solve it. I've uninstalled and reinstalled several times solidworks, visual studios, microsoft office... but it continue to give me the same error. I have an HP Pavillon, 700gb free hard disk, 12gb RAM (so I'm not low on disc space!!), x64 bit operating system. Do you have an antivirus program running while installing, try uninstalling? Are you running a compatible version of office? I would make sure to install office before Solidworks.
 
I've installed solidworks switching off the antivirus (F-secure). I've installed office 2013 before, which is compatible with solidworks 2015 (the solidworks'site say that). I also tried to uninstall and reinstalling both (before office and then solidworks) but nothing was changed.
Any ideas why?
 
Sounds like its a .NET frameworks issue. If you have the latest release of .NET, then you might need to remove it and reinstall that. However before you just go out and do it research the process as I know it can be a PITA.

Also, I would ask your professor to contact their support if you have it. Your attachment didn't work either so I cannot see your message.

I decided to restore the computer as new to windows 8. Then I've reinstalled in order windows 10, office 2015 and solidworks and now it functions!!
